Jemele Hill feels that her suspension was 100% warranted from ESPN. As you know, the sports commentator was suspended for two weeks by the network over her social media use. Hill, who returns to ESPN on Monday, says of her suspension:
I put ESPN in a bad spot. I deserved a suspension. I violated the policy. Going forward we’ll be in a good healthy place.
She continues,
I don’t feel suppressed. I love ESPN as much as ever. I am okay. I feel good.
As previously reported, earlier this month, ESPN announced Hill was suspended for a “second violation of our social media guidelines”. Hill suggested fans upset with Jerry Jones’s threat (to bench any player who does “anything that is disrespectful to the flag”) should boycott the advertisers who support Jones and the Dallas Cowboys.
